(ESSERE IN) GAMBA – Word of the Week today is GAMBA: la gamba – (leg), le gambe (legs)

In Italian we say “ ESSERE IN GAMBA” for being clever, intelligent, capable, skilled, strong . It comes from “CAMMINARE SULLE PROPRIE GAMBE” , walking without help, being able to handle any situation.
The expression is also used for “ being healthy and in good shape”, being fit.

More expressions with Gambe:

Mandare tutto a gambe all’aria : head over heels; to go belly up
Darsela a gambe: to take to one’a heels
Prendere sotto gamba: Underestimate something ; not to take seriously
